Tosefta

Tosefta , plural Toseftoth [Aramaic,=additional], collection of ancient Jewish teachings supplementing the Mishna or Oral Law and closely allied to it in organization. Like the Mishna, it was compiled by the Tannaim . Many of its teachings, called Baraitot, do not appear in the Mishna; others are merely elucidations or alternative versions of Mishnaic material. It contains a larger percentage of aggadic material than does the Mishna. The Tosefta is an independent work and has been made the subject of commentaries.

Tosefta

Tosefta. A collection of works by the Jewish tannaim. The Tosefta parallels and supplements the Mishnah. It dates from c.2nd cent. CE, and has the same six orders as the Mishnah.

Tosefta

Tosefta (Heb., ‘supplement’). A collection of early Jewish traditions of the same character as, and contemporary with, the Mishnah, but not incorporated in it.

tosefta

tosefta Aramaic for ‘addition’; consisting of commentary on the Mishnah compiled in the 3rd cent. CE.
